The Novo Nordisk Foundation Challenge Programme 2027 is seeking leading researchers to form interdisciplinary research consortia capable of addressing a major global health challenge: the development of next-generation antimicrobial resistance (AMR) diagnostics for lower respiratory tract infections (LRTIs).
LRTIs cause substantial hospitalisation and mortality worldwide, while approximately 20–30% are associated with antibiotic-resistant pathogens. Existing diagnosis and antimicrobial susceptibility testing can be too slow or inaccurate to guide timely treatment, contributing to inappropriate use of broad-spectrum antibiotics. The challenge is particularly significant in low-resource settings, where few rapid antimicrobial susceptibility testing technologies can currently replace conventional bacteriology.
The programme is therefore seeking early-stage proof-of-concept research that can lay the scientific foundation for rapid, minimally invasive and affordable point-of-care testing for LRTIs in global settings.

RESEARCH AREAS SUPPORTED
The guidelines identify several areas of research that may be supported.
1. Improving Respiratory Sample Collection & Processing
Projects may develop technological advances such as:
- Microfluidics
- Optics
- Biosensing
- Other promising technologies
to improve respiratory sample collection or processing and enable rapid pathogen separation and/or concentration.
2. Minimally Invasive Sampling & Biomarkers
Research may focus on establishing the scientific and clinical validity of minimally invasive techniques and identifying relevant biomarkers from proxy samples.
Potential sample types include:
- Breath
- Blood
- Urine
- Upper respiratory samples
Research may involve:
- Transcriptomics
- Metabolomics
- Proteomics
- Host-response analysis
- Pathogen identification
- Antibiotic susceptibility.
3. Host & Pathogen Biomarkers / Biometrics
Projects may discover host or pathogen analytes or biometrics that help distinguish between:
- Commensal organisms
- Disease-causing pathogens
Methods may include:
- Supervised machine learning.
- Mining existing datasets.
- Mining sample biobanks.
- Antibody-response analysis.
- Antigen detection.
The aim is to identify signals that can support prediction of LRTI and/or its aetiology.
4. Genotype–Phenotype Correlations for AMR
Research may advance predictive capabilities of antimicrobial susceptibility gene testing by establishing and optimising accurate genotype–phenotype correlations.

IMPORTANT — WHAT IS OUT OF SCOPE?
The guidelines specifically exclude:
- Projects mainly focused on surveillance.
- Projects focused primarily on establishing or maintaining infrastructure.
- Projects mainly focused on clinical trials.
- For-profit product development projects.
This is an important distinction: the funding is for early-stage proof-of-concept research, not for commercially developing or optimising an existing product.
WHO CAN APPLY?
Consortium Requirement
Applications must be submitted as a consortium consisting of:
2–4 research groups
made up of:
- 1 Main Applicant
- 1–3 Co-applicants.
Main Applicant
The Main Applicant must be:
- An independent tenured or tenure-track researcher.
- Leading their own research group.
- Employed at a European university, hospital or non-profit research organisation.
For this call, European means:
European Union + Schengen Area + United Kingdom.
The host institution will administer the grant.
The Main Applicant must also:
- Be employed at the host institution with at least 75% commitment.
- Have their salary guaranteed for the entire project period.
INTERNATIONAL PARTICIPATION
This is an important feature of the call for the Innovation Bridge audience.
Co-applicants
Co-applicant institutions may be located anywhere in the world.
Therefore, researchers and institutions outside Europe can potentially participate as co-applicants in a qualifying European-led consortium.
Mandatory Danish Connection
At least one applicant — either the Main Applicant or a Co-applicant — must be employed at least 75% and have their research group at a Danish university, hospital or non-profit research organisation at the time of submission.
This means the opportunity is genuinely international in its collaboration model, but it is not an open standalone international grant.
For example, an African university or research institute could potentially participate as a co-applicant, but the consortium must still satisfy the European Main Applicant requirement and the mandatory Danish research-group connection.

FUNDING
The Challenge has a total available budget of:
Up to DKK 150 million
Individual grants will range between:
DKK 30 million and DKK 75 million
with projects lasting:
6 years.
APPLICATION PROCESS
The application is conducted in two stages.
Stage 1 — Expression of Interest
Applicants submit an Expression of Interest of up to:
10,000 characters
together with a preliminary budget.
After the initial evaluation, shortlisted applicants are invited to Stage 2.
Stage 2 — Full Proposal
Shortlisted applicants submit:
- A comprehensive application.
- Detailed research proposal.
- Detailed budget.
The Stage 2 project description may contain up to:
30,000 characters.
Applicants will also be invited to present and discuss their proposed research with the review panel in an online meeting during Stage 2.

ELIGIBLE COSTS
The grant can support directly related project costs.
Personnel
Funding may cover salaries for:
- Technicians.
- Analysts.
- Technical assistance.
- Laboratory administrators.
- Postdoctoral researchers.
- PhD students.
- Employees or project consultants.
- Project management.
The Main Applicant and Co-applicants cannot receive funding for their own salaries.
Operations & Research
Eligible costs include:
- Materials.
- Consumables.
- Animals.
- Services.
- High-end computing.
- Essential equipment.
- Required infrastructure.
- Subcontractors.
- Bench fees.
Collaboration & Dissemination
The grant may support:
- Workshops.
- Meetings.
- Research exchanges.
- Seminars.
- Collaboration activities.
- Travel.
- Publication.
- Communication and outreach.
- PhD tuition fees of up to DKK 80,000 per year.
Administration
Direct administrative costs may be included up to:
5% of the overall budget.
IMPORTANT FUNDING EXCLUSIONS
The Foundation will not fund:
- Salary for the Main Applicant or Co-applicants.
- Commercial activities.
- General overhead/indirect costs such as rent, electricity, water and maintenance.
- Double funding or overlapping project costs.
If an applicant has received or applied for other funding relating to the proposed project, this must be disclosed in the budget/application.
